Definition of Industrialization

The Canada social science dictionary [1] provides the following meaning of Industrialization: The process of developing an economy founded on the mass manufacturing of goods. Industrialization is associated with the urbanization of society, an extensive division of labour, a wage economy, differentiation of institutions, and growth of mass communication and mass markets. Many western societies are now described as post-industrial since much economic activity is based on the production of services, knowledge or symbols.
